Late blue panel A106. So BOL they used the laundromat ring on the PF agitator; no complimentary lint filter or dispenser here. One to love about these old-time Tags: the BOL's were just as well made as the TOL's.
Very nice blue tub in better condition, it seems, than the rest of the unit. If only it were in Connecticut. This thing will still be working in 2030. |
